N.J. Stat. Ann. § 44:6-1

Maintenance by municipalities of clinics for indigent children

The board or body having control of the finances of a municipality may appropriate annually such sum as it may deem advisable to be used and applied only for the maintenance and equipment of a dental clinic or clinics in the municipality for the free treatment of indigent persons of school age.
